Escaping from their dysfunctional families, Behiye and Handan become best friends. Their euphoria will soon be replaced by regrets and eventual betrayal as class differences resurface.

AI Analysis
Kutluğ Ataman’s work succeeds by placing marginalized identities at the very heart of the narrative. By centering the relationship between Behiye and Handan, the film moves beyond mere representation to explore the profound impact of queer identity on the coming-of-age experience. The film effectively challenges social structures by focusing on female agency and the friction between individual desire and societal expectations. This shift from male-dominated perspectives to female subjectivity provides a powerful critique of traditional domesticity. While the film is culturally specific to a Turkish context, it avoids the pitfalls of generic storytelling. It uses its setting to explore how class and tradition shape personal identity and freedom.
